Background
The wood is also called log, and is a wood section with a certain length specified by the standard or special specification of size, shape and quality in the length direction of raw wood strips. The length of the general regulated material is not more than 12m or 40 feet, and the special material has great application in various aspects such as buildings, furniture, art engraving, paper making and the like. Wood is used in different ways according to its different properties. During the processing and use of wood, the wood is often required to be cut.
Traditional wood cutting machine includes cutting blade and safety cover, and the cutting machine is installed inside the safety cover, and the safety cover is connected with the handle, cuts timber through the handle of artifical manual control cutting machine, and this kind of traditional cutting machine not only wastes time and energy, and work efficiency is not high moreover, probably leads to cutting improperly because of the human factor in the time of the cutting, can not obtain qualified timber.

In this embodiment, the wood chip collecting box 8 includes a second motor 81 and a second electric telescopic rod 82, the second motor 81 is connected with the second electric telescopic rod 82 in a transmission manner, and a pressing block 83 is arranged at the bottom of the second electric telescopic rod 82.
When the saw-dust needs to be compressed, the second motor 81 drives the second electric telescopic rod 82 to extend and rotate, the pressing block 83 is driven to move downwards, the saw-dust is compressed by the pressing block 83, after the saw-dust is compressed, the second motor 81 drives the second electric telescopic rod 82 to extend and contract and rotate, the pressing block 83 is driven to move upwards, and the next compression is waited.
This saw-dust collecting box 8 can collect and compress a large amount of saw-dusts that produce when cutting timber, not only makes workman's operational environment cleaner, has practiced thrift the resource moreover, compares with traditional compressing mechanism, and this kind of compression structure's design is simple, the effect is better, and is also very high to the saving efficiency of manpower resources.
In this embodiment, the bottom of the machine body 1 is provided with a retractable supporting frame 11, and the supporting frame 11 is provided with a shock-absorbing rubber pad 111.
Therefore, vibration can be effectively reduced, and stable operation of equipment is guaranteed.
In this embodiment, the cutting housing 43 is provided with a cavity therein, a through hole 431 is formed at the top end of the cutting housing 43, and the first electric telescopic rod 5 penetrates through the cavity of the cutting housing 43 through the through hole 431.
The cutting shell with the specific design works together with the first electric telescopic rod 5, and meanwhile, the wood chips are prevented from splashing.
In this embodiment, the sound absorbing layers 411 are disposed on both the inner and outer surfaces of the protection cover 41.
The cutting machine can produce the noise when work, and for noise abatement pollution, the noise layer 411 is inhaled to the installation of safety cover 41 surface, can effectively alleviate the noise that takes place when wood cutting machine operates like this, has improved wood cutting work efficiency.
In this embodiment, the outer surface of the chassis 44 is provided with ventilation and heat dissipation holes 441, and the ventilation and heat dissipation holes 441 are uniformly distributed on the chassis 44.
The heat generated by the case 44 can be dissipated by the ventilation and heat dissipation holes 441, and the internal waste heat is discharged, so that the case 44 is prevented from being damaged due to high temperature.
In this embodiment, the case 44 is provided with an emergency stop switch 442 and a recovery switch 443, and one side of the outer surface of the case 44 is provided with a display 444.
When the cutting device 4 is not operated properly, the emergency stop switch 442 is pressed down to perform emergency stop processing, the wood cutting machine is effectively protected, the reset switch 443 facilitates the whole device to enter a safety precaution mode, and the display screen 444 facilitates monitoring of the working state of the device.
In this embodiment, a conveyor switch 31 and a speed-adjusting button 32 are disposed on one side of the outer surface of the conveyor 3.
The conveyer switch 31 controls the conveyer 3 to work, and the speed regulating button 32 is convenient for controlling the conveying speed of the conveyer 3.
